Output 64fc24dbb2f8029ef10ed773d7fdb75cff977df27ce340704afa5e996bd2a9eb:3

value
41051241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92354380d6966e00bef99f55834e4a3d2e9b0d5e OP_EQUAL
address
MMEEhGDPTjgukEGd3emnsc34gPnuuhz2PT
transaction
64fc24dbb2f8029ef10ed773d7fdb75cff977df27ce340704afa5e996bd2a9eb
spent
true